    Custodial history

    The De Laval Chapter was established on Thursday, 19th of October, 1939. It was the only francophone chapter in Sherbrooke. For many years, it raised money for different causes. The chapter disbanded on Wednesday, January 25th, 1956 since any members were willing to take the responsibilities and duties of being regents.

    Scope and content

    The series provides primary sources regarding the work of the De Laval Chapter from 1939 to 1956. The series is composed of the following sub-series: Organisation administrative (1939-1956), Rapports annuels (1941-[195-?]), Ressources financières (1945-1955), Liste des membres (1955), Correspondance générale (1953-1954), and Documents divers (1939-1956).
